#ifndef RTLD_MACHDEP_H
#define	RTLD_MACHDEP_H	1

#include <sys/types.h>
#include <machine/atomic.h>
#include <machine/tls.h>

struct Struct_Obj_Entry;

/* Return the address of the .dynamic section in the dynamic linker. */
#define	rtld_dynamic(obj)						\
({									\
	Elf_Addr _dynamic_addr;						\
	asm volatile("adr	%0, _DYNAMIC" : "=&r"(_dynamic_addr));	\
	(const Elf_Dyn *)_dynamic_addr;					\
})

bool arch_digest_note(struct Struct_Obj_Entry *obj, const Elf_Note *note);

Elf_Addr reloc_jmpslot(Elf_Addr *where, Elf_Addr target,
    const struct Struct_Obj_Entry *defobj, const struct Struct_Obj_Entry *obj,
    const Elf_Rel *rel);

#define	make_function_pointer(def, defobj) \
	((defobj)->relocbase + (def)->st_value)

#define	call_initfini_pointer(obj, target) \
	(((InitFunc)(target))())

#define	call_init_pointer(obj, target) \
	(((InitArrFunc)(target))(main_argc, main_argv, environ))

/*
 * Pass zeros into the ifunc resolver so we can change them later. The first
 * 8 arguments on arm64 are passed in registers so make them known values
 * if we decide to use them later. Because of this ifunc resolvers can assume
 * no arguments are passed in, and if this changes later will be able to
 * compare the argument with 0 to see if it is set.
 */
#define	call_ifunc_resolver(ptr) \
	(((Elf_Addr (*)(uint64_t, uint64_t, uint64_t, uint64_t, uint64_t, \
	    uint64_t, uint64_t, uint64_t))ptr)(0, 0, 0, 0, 0, 0, 0, 0))

#define	round(size, align)				\
	(((size) + (align) - 1) & ~((align) - 1))
#define	calculate_first_tls_offset(size, align, offset)	\
	round(16, align)
#define	calculate_tls_offset(prev_offset, prev_size, size, align, offset) \
	round(prev_offset + prev_size, align)
#define calculate_tls_post_size(align) \
	round(TLS_TCB_SIZE, align) - TLS_TCB_SIZE

typedef struct {
    unsigned long ti_module;
    unsigned long ti_offset;
} tls_index;

extern void *__tls_get_addr(tls_index *ti);

#define md_abi_variant_hook(x)

#endif
